Entity Gaming's Independence League featuring Indian and Indonesian PUBG Mobile teams set to kick off later today

Entity Gaming’s Independence League, is back with its second iteration which features top teams from India and Indonesia. The first season saw teams from India and Pakistan face off in a series of friendly show matches to celebrate the occasion of Independence Day in the month of August.

Season 2 features a stacked list of 20 teams (10 from India and 10 from Indonesia) who will play out 3 maps. The complete list of teams are as follows:

India - Team IND, Team INS, Godlike, SouL, ETG.Brawlers, XSpark, 8bit, 8bit Revenge, Orange Rock Esports, Mega X

Indonesia - Aura Esports, Onic, Bigetron, BOOM ID, Alter Ego, Onic Ladies, Star8, Louvre, Elite8, Belletron

The list of teams includes some impressive names such as Orange Rock Esports, XSpark and Mega X who have been in top form, dominating the PMCO South Asia Qualifiers. Elsewhere in Indonesia Bigetron have proved themselves to be the best team not just in their country but in the entirety of SEA, having placed head and shoulders above the competition in the currently ongoing PMCO Fall SEA League. The clash certainly looks enticing and will provide the Indian teams a perspective on how they stand against some of the best teams in the world. 

Games will go live from 6pm on Entity Gaming’s YouTube channel and will be casted by Ketan ‘K18’Patel.
